首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

在sqlite中移动行(位置列)

在SQLite中移动行(位置列)是指对数据库表中的数据进行重新排序或移动操作。SQLite是一种轻量级的关系型数据库管理系统,支持SQL语法,并提供了一种称为"ROWID"的内置列,用于唯一标识表中的每一行。

要在SQLite中移动行,可以使用UPDATE语句来修改表中的数据。具体步骤如下:

  1. 确定目标行:首先,需要确定要移动的行。可以使用WHERE子句来指定条件,以筛选出需要移动的行。例如,可以根据行的特定值或条件来选择需要移动的行。
  2. 更新行的位置列:一旦确定了要移动的行,可以使用UPDATE语句来更新目标行的位置列。位置列是指表中用于排序的列,它可以是任何适合用于排序的列,比如日期列或数字列。通过更新位置列的值,可以改变行的顺序。
  3. 重新排序数据:更新位置列后,可以使用ORDER BY子句来重新排序数据。ORDER BY子句允许按照位置列或其他列对数据进行排序。例如,可以按照位置列的升序或降序对数据进行排序,以反映行的新位置。

在SQLite中移动行的应用场景可以是调整数据的顺序,使其符合特定的排序要求,或者在特定条件下对数据进行重新排序。例如,可以根据用户的偏好对数据进行自定义排序,或者根据某个指标对数据进行重新排序以提高查询性能。

在腾讯云相关产品中,与SQLite相关的产品可能较少,因为SQLite通常用于嵌入式和移动设备应用程序开发。腾讯云主要提供了云数据库 TencentDB 产品系列,包括云数据库 MySQL、云数据库 MariaDB、云数据库 PostgreSQL等,可以满足各类应用的数据库需求。

更多关于腾讯云数据库产品的信息,请访问腾讯云官方网站:https://cloud.tencent.com/product/cdb

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

领券